What is best to use for river largemouth bass fishing? Monofilament, fluorocarbon, or braided? What pound test?

  • Super User
Posted

Depends what lures you plan on fishing? What type of river are we talking? The answer could range from 6lb fluorocarbon if you are fishing for smallies in the st Lawrence or 80lb braid fishing thick lily pads in an oxbow somewhere.

As Blubasser86 stated, many of us use different lines for specific techniques.

If you are more interested in "all-around" line I would suggest #6 monofilament

for spinning tackle and #12 mono for baitcasting.

 

This is how I roll:

Spinning: #4 Yo-Zuri Hybrid

Jigs and weighted soft plastics:  Tatsu #15 or #40 Smackdown with Tatsu leader

Treble hooks:  Sunline Shooter Defier Armilo #11

I like Berkley Trilene XT 8lb on spinning gear and 12lb on Baitcasters.

 

I also use Kastking Superpower braid 30lb and Kastking Fluorokote 8-12lb depending on the lures I am fishing or cover I am fishing in. 

 

Those 3 lines are what I use the most when river fishing

Posted

Not knowing more details I would recomend Suffix 832 20ib if I could only go with one line. Use it as is for topwater or add different floro leader for most everyting else. The lb test of the leader can be changed based on what you are fishing with.
